Product information "Ceremin 240 mg film-coated tablets"

Beipackzettel ansehen

Ceremin 240 mg film-coated tablets are a herbal medicine for use in cases of reduced brain performance with poor concentration and memory, cold hands and feet with numbness, tingling or calf pain when walking.

Ceremin 240 mg film-coated tablets contain a special extract known as EGb 761® from the leaves of the ginkgo tree, which promotes blood circulation, particularly in the area of very small blood vessels. This leads to a better supply of blood and oxygen to the body tissue in the brain as well as in the legs and arms. At the same time, Ceremin 240 mg - film-coated tablets protect the body tissue from harmful effects caused by a lack of oxygen supply to the tissue.

Indications

  • For the treatment of symptoms associated with a decline in brain performance with poor concentration and memory.
  • For use in cases of cold hands and feet, symptoms such as tingling and formication, discomfort when walking and in connection with mild circulatory disorders after a serious illness has been ruled out.

This medicine is used in adults.


Dosage form
tablets

Dosage
  • Adults: 1 film-coated tablet once daily.
  • Route of administration: Oral use: Take the film-coated tablet whole with sufficient liquid (preferably a glass of drinking water). It can be taken independently of meals.
  • Duration of use: The treatment should last at least 8 weeks. If you do not feel better or even worse after 3 months, consult your doctor.
  • Use in children and adolescents: The use of Ceremin 240 mg in children and adolescents under 18 years of age is not recommended.

Ingredients
  • The active ingredient is: dry extract of ginkgo leaves
  • 1 film-coated tablet contains: 240 mg dry extract of ginkgo leaves (Ginkgonis folium) (EGb 761®) (drug extract ratio (DEV) = 35 - 67:1). The extract is quantified to 52.8 - 64.8 mg ginkgo flavone glycosides and 12.96 - 15.84 mg terpene lactones, of which 6.72 - 8.16 mg ginkgolides A, B and C and 6.24 - 7.68 mg bilobalide. Extractant: acetone 60% (m/m).
  • The other ingredients are: lactose monohydrate, highly dispersed silicon dioxide, microcrystalline cellulose, maize starch, croscarmellose sodium, magnesium stearate, hypromellose, macrogol 1500, dimethicone, macrogol stearyl ether, sorbic acid, titanium dioxide (E-171), iron oxide yellow (E-172), talc
